Sentence examples for an attitude of silence from inspiring English sources

The phrase "an attitude of silence"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a state of being quiet or reserved, often in a context where silence is intentional or significant.
Example: "During the meeting, there was an attitude of silence as everyone contemplated the gravity of the situation."
Alternatives: "a demeanor of quiet" or "a disposition of silence".
